Israeli airstrikes on two schools sheltering displaced persons in Gaza’s Jabalia leave several casualties

GAZA, October 20, 2024 (WAFA) - Several Palestinians were killed and others were injured on Sunday night in Israeli airstrikes targeting two schools sheltering internally displaced persons in Jabalia in the northern Gaza Strip.

Local sources indicated that Israeli artillery shelled the UNRWA-run Hafsa School in Jabalia refugee camp, resulting in numerous casualties among those sheltering inside.

Israeli forces also bombed the Abu Hussein School in the Jabalia camp, causing additional fatalities and injuries. Meanwhile, civil defense teams were also banned from accessing the area to rescue those trapped under the rubble and injured.

Furthermore, the Israeli military caused fire to break out at the Hamad School, which was providing shelter to displaced individuals adjacent to the Indonesian Hospital in northern Gaza, causing flames to spread to the hospital's generators.

Several Palestinians were also reported killed following Israeli airstrikes targeting the al-Fakhura area in northern Gaza and Al-Hattab Street in Beit Lahia.

In the al-Tuffah neighborhood of Gaza City, Israeli forces targeted a group of civilians, leading to further casualties.

Additionally, an Israeli drone strike struck a vehicle in Deir al-Balah, killing three civilians.

Since the onset of the ongoing relentless Israeli aggression against the Palestinian people on October 7, 2023, by land, sea and air, an estimated 42,603 civilians were killed and 99,795 others were wounded, mostly women and children.

Thousands remain missing under the rubble and scattered on the streets.
